博图如何批量注释

博图如何批量注释,第1张

使用SCL语言编程方法简介

SCL语言基本语法规则:表达式

第一个SCL程序

SCL语法规则:变量、地址、寻罩悔誉址

使用梯形图编写程序时,博途编辑器是通过网络段,把程序分成一段一段的,编辑器可以插入若干个网络段,每一个网络段可以有各自的注释

而SCL是文本语言,不分网络段(在LAD/FBD语言内增加SCL的除外),这就需要需要用其他的方法来,解决程序分段的问题。

把SCL划分的合理且清晰,我们可以使用注释和代码折叠指令划分的功能进行。

1、注释

合理的注释可以增加程序的可读性,也便于以后功能的升级和维护。

博途SCL编辑器的注释分为两种:行注释和段注释。

行注释://  注释内容

段注释:(*  注释内容  *)

可以在工具栏中利用按钮整段注释或取消注释。添加注释的方法如下图所示:

① 注释掉选中段落

② 对注释掉的段落取消注释 

当我们有需要注释掉的内容时,可以先把需要注释掉的语句选中,让后点击①按钮,这样就批量的把选中的内容注释掉了。

具体 *** 作如下:

先选中想要注释掉的代码,然后点击工具栏上的添加注释图标。

选中已经添加注释的程序后,再次点击工具栏上的取消注释图标。

除了以上可以批量注释,我们还可以通过段注释的方式,把一大段程序注释掉。

可以按照上图中的方式,点击右侧指令栏,选中段注释指令。也可以在英文输入环境下,直接输入 (* 和 *) 两个符号。

刚开始使用SCL编程时,通过指令栏选中比较方便,熟练后直接输入回大大提高编程效率。

2、代码折叠

从TIA PORTAL V14以后,增加区间REGION指令,使用改指令可以把部分代码进行折叠隐藏。

通过REGION指令把功能相对独立的代码折叠起来,使整个程序块更加的简洁,便于阅读。特别是某个功能比较复杂时,折叠的方式能让编程思路更加富有逻辑。

REGION指令的使用格式如下:

REGION <名称>

<指令> 

END_REGION

可以在指令中间增加需要编写的程序还不影响程序逻辑,并且支持嵌套。此外还可以像网络段一样收折叠来,如图7所示。

从上图中可以看出,REGION指令支持嵌套和对区间进行命名。

REGION指令的使用也非常简单,直接从右侧指令栏中拖拽到程序段中即可,如下图所示:

拖拽到程序后,需要在_name_处修改成有实际意义的名称,比如上面的Function01和Function02。

上图中的Function01区间是展开的,能看到区间的程序代码。Function02区间是折叠的,这区间中的代码是折叠起来的。

代码的注释在使用SCL编程时,非常重要,除了增加可读性,便于后期维护。还可以通过注解的方式,在调试过程中逐步进行功能测试。

作者自我介绍:工控小周

人们中眼的天才之所以卓越非凡,并非天资超人一等,而是付出了持续不断的努力。1万小时的锤炼是任何人从平凡变成超凡的必要条件。按比例计算就是:如果每天工作八个小时,一周工作五天,那么成为一个领域的专家至少需要五年。我从信捷(干了五年)出来后,做物段过步科独立销售,做过北辰 自己单干过 ,可是我发现通用品越来越难做,生意越来越难做,但是生活还得继续下去,我就在想,白天想,夜里想 突然想到2011年认识的巨控的总经理,他有好的产品,无线远程监控模块GRM500,于是我从无锡硕放飞广州, 经培训成了巨控产品经理,在巨控负责销售和技术,并且一直努力专注下去!一直前敬不忘初心,经常奔赴第一现场,进行项目评估,项目实施,数据采集,工业物联通讯,上位机,APP组态等。159618(工控小周)72327创建西门子WINCC社区

本文禁止转载或摘编

2

12

1

推荐文章

勿忘南京大屠杀

日常 · 173阅读

韩娱热议: 宋智雅公开自己婚纱照,“邀请到我的婚礼...”美若天仙

日常 · 38.5万阅读

热门评论(2)

请先登录后发表评论 (・ω・)

表情发布

工控小周

UP

8-7

微信技术交流群

西门子 TIA 社区

(加好友请标注:姓名-单位)加V:15961872327

我是小锅童鞋

8-5

遇到对的人很重要啊

打开App,看更多精彩内容

打开博图软件-项目视图,点击菜单栏中的“选择”,然后点击“设置”。进入到设置界面后,点击“PLC编程”,点击”常规“选项,然后勾选”显示程序段注释知判“,即可显山衫示注释。搭唯改

如果是想要添加注释的话,如果是梯形图程序块里面插入程序段,那该程序段也具备梯形图的段前注释功能。如果是想要在REGION空格后注释,则后面空一格就可以添加区域注释。打开博图软件-项目视图,点击菜单栏中的“选择”,然后点击“设置”。进入到设置界面后,点击“PLC编程”,点击”常规“选项,然后勾选”显示程序段注释“,即可显示注释。


欢迎分享,转载请注明来源:内存溢出

原文地址: http://outofmemory.cn/yw/12489112.html

(0)
打赏 微信扫一扫 微信扫一扫 支付宝扫一扫 支付宝扫一扫
上一篇 2023-05-25
下一篇 2023-05-25

发表评论

登录后才能评论

评论列表(0条)

保存